Can I ask why you need a 17" spacesaver?

On my standard 3.0 which is prefacelift and judging by the signature which yours is too then the 16" fits perfectly. Common an cheap

I upgraded to a 17" only when I later fitted bigger E46 330 calipers and rotors.

In terms of jacks, etc you can strap a scissor jack in the lower NS of the engine bay right at the bottom behing the wheel arch where there is a big void. Brace and jack handle will fit int he battery box.

The £42 price posted above is the rim only. Double it at least to add the tyre
